ios测试基础五:ios手机流量消耗-创新互联

iOS手机流量消耗

成都创新互联公司专注于上思企业网站建设,响应式网站设计,电子商务商城网站建设。上思网站建设公司,为上思等地区提供建站服务。全流程按需定制设计,专业设计,全程项目跟踪,成都创新互联公司专业和态度为您提供的服务

在iphone手机上使用wifi或者数据连接方式,操作某个应用下某个场景,实时监测流量消耗情况:

(一般情况下,更多地要关注 数据连接2G或3G或4G 下流量消耗情况)

前提准备:

1. xcode

2. instruments(7.1.1版本):Network Activity

操作步骤:

1. 打开instrments,iphone连接上mac电脑(手机开启 数据连接 模式);

2.选择连接上的Iphone手机,再选择好待监控的应用;

ios测试基础五: ios手机流量消耗

3.在Library下选择Network Activity 模式,用于监控网络

ios测试基础五: ios手机流量消耗

4.点击 红***标,进行网络数据包实时监控

ios测试基础五: ios手机流量消耗

5.如果是wifi连接,查看上表中wifi开头的数据,如果是 数据连接,查看上表中cell 相关的数据;

ios测试基础五: ios手机流量消耗

=======以上步骤,在手机上操作的同时,可能观察这个表格内的流量 包消耗情况,in out 分别为接收到和发送的流量数据,packets为数据包的个数;

=======可以选择左边time排序,让最新的数据包显示在最上方;

=======上半部分的时间轴图表可以看到 时间点-数据消耗-数据包个数;

应用场景说明:

1. 一般用于测试第二阶段,在第一轮功能测试完成后;

2. 测试场景有:

  •   整体观察:应用 在使用过程中的 流量消耗,比如,应用初启动过程、正常使用应用内功能的过程等;

  •  后台静默:将应用使用过程中,切回后台放置10分钟左右,观察这个过程中实时流量消耗,正常不应该出现太多消耗;

  •  特定场景:根据应用特点,分析出需要大量消耗流量的场景,进行单独操作和测试,比如,同步开始-同步结束,过程中流量消耗;

可能问题点:

  •   错误流量消耗,在不需要消耗流量的场景下消耗流量,比如,在云笔记编辑器里操作数据时,不需要消耗流量,如果有消耗,就有问题;

  •   重复且固定频繁的流量消耗,  在某些场景下,出现 一些重复的非业务需要的且固定的流量消耗,肯定是有问题的。比如一定频率下出现一次固定的流量消耗,不属于正常的业务消耗范围内;

官网权威使用说明:

https://developer.apple.com/library/prerelease/tvos/documentation/AnalysisTools/Reference/Instruments_User_Reference/WiFiInstrument/WiFiInstrument.html#//apple_ref/doc/uid/TP40011355-CH32-SW1

另外有需要云服务器可以了解下创新互联scvps.cn,海内外云服务器15元起步,三天无理由+7*72小时售后在线,公司持有idc许可证,提供“云服务器、裸金属服务器、高防服务器、香港服务器、美国服务器、虚拟主机、免备案服务器”等云主机租用服务以及企业上云的综合解决方案,具有“安全稳定、简单易用、服务可用性高、性价比高”等特点与优势,专为企业上云打造定制,能够满足用户丰富、多元化的应用场景需求。


分享文章:ios测试基础五:ios手机流量消耗-创新互联
URL链接:http://pwwzsj.com/article/jsjsc.html